Output 73f6f1913cd631856bc34d0cb3cade04da9fc918e49c5ae916d39ac8285efd9f:6

value
21210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d537560ecd9df3540ff360e366409b49ec9bd57 OP_EQUAL
address
3ACUkBZduGhayYjiv3DukY4iow9H2hTrhQ
transaction
73f6f1913cd631856bc34d0cb3cade04da9fc918e49c5ae916d39ac8285efd9f
spent
true